# compute the factorial of 5, and return the result in the exit code
|
|
#
|
|
# To run:
|
|
# $ ./translate apps/factorial.mu
|
|
# $ ./a.elf
|
|
# $ echo $?
|
|
# 120
|
|
#
|
|
# You can also run the automated test suite:
|
|
# $ ./a.elf test
|
|
# Expected output:
|
|
# ........
|
|
# Every '.' indicates a passing test. Failing tests get a 'F'.
|
|
# There's only one test in this file, but you'll also see tests running from
|
|
# Mu's standard library.
|
|
#
|
|
# Compare factorial4.subx
|
|
|
|
fn factorial n: int -> _/eax: int {
|
|
compare n, 1
|
|
# if (n <= 1) return 1
|
|
{
|
|
break-if->
|
|
return 1
|
|
}
|
|
# n > 1; return n * factorial(n-1)
|
|
var tmp/ecx: int <- copy n
|
|
tmp <- decrement
|
|
var result/eax: int <- factorial tmp
|
|
result <- multiply n
|
|
return result
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
fn test-factorial {
|
|
var result/eax: int <- factorial 5
|
|
check-ints-equal result, 0x78, "F - test-factorial"
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
fn main args-on-stack: (addr array addr array byte) -> _/ebx: int {
|
|
var args/eax: (addr array addr array byte) <- copy args-on-stack
|
|
# len = length(args)
|
|
var len/ecx: int <- length args
|
|
# if (len <= 1) return factorial(5)
|
|
compare len, 1
|
|
{
|
|
break-if->
|
|
var exit-status/eax: int <- factorial 5
|
|
return exit-status
|
|
}
|
|
# if (args[1] == "test") run-tests()
|
|
var tmp2/ecx: (addr addr array byte) <- index args, 1
|
|
var tmp3/eax: boolean <- string-equal? *tmp2, "test"
|
|
compare tmp3, 0
|
|
{
|
|
break-if-=
|
|
run-tests
|
|
# TODO: get at Num-test-failures somehow
|
|
}
|
|
return 0
|
|
}
